Find the best attractions near Emerald Bay State Park

Emerald Bay State Park offers a plethora of outdoor adventures and cultural experiences, making it a must-visit destination. Travelers can explore the stunning Emerald Bay, relax at Tahoe Beach, and enjoy the nearby ski resorts. For those seeking more excitement, Lake Tahoe and South Lake Tahoe provide additional attractions and opportunities for adventure. This beautiful area is perfect for tourists looking to immerse themselves in nature and local culture.

  • Heavenly Ski Resort: Just 11 miles from Emerald Bay, Heavenly Ski Resort offers thrilling outdoor adventures year-round. In winter, hit the slopes with stunning views of Lake Tahoe, while summer activities include hiking and mountain biking, perfect for adrenaline enthusiasts.
  • Fallen Leaf Lake: Located only 4 miles away, Fallen Leaf Lake is a serene escape known for its romantic ambiance and picturesque beach. Enjoy kayaking, picnicking, or simply soaking in the breathtaking scenery surrounded by towering pines.
  • Vikingsholm: A mere 0.2 miles from the park, Vikingsholm is a beautiful historic mansion that reflects Scandinavian architecture. Explore its fascinating history and enjoy guided tours that showcase the rich culture of the area.

The nearest major airports for your trip to Emerald Bay State Park

Emerald Bay State Park is conveniently accessible via three major airports. Reno-Tahoe International Airport (RNO) is 42 miles away, with nearby hotels like the Grand Sierra Resort and Casino and Peppermill Resort Spa Casino, both just 1 mile from the airport. Lake Tahoe Airport (TVL), located 7 miles away, offers luxurious options such as Edgewood Tahoe Resort and The Landing Resort & Spa. Truckee Tahoe Airport (TKF) is 25 miles from the park, with excellent accommodations including The Ritz-Carlton, Lake Tahoe, just 4 miles away. Each airport provides various transportation services to ensure a smooth journey to Emerald Bay.

What can I see and do near Emerald Bay State Park?

Learn about local history at Vikingsholm and Tallac Historic Site. Dip your toes in the water at Pope Beach, Baldwin Beach, and Kiva Beach. At Fallen Leaf Lake, Eagle Falls Trail, and Inspiration Point, take some time to really appreciate nature.
